Intravenous catheter insertion device with retractable needle
First Claim
1. An intravenous catheter insertion device for inserting a catheter sleeve with associated hub for providing medicinals to a patient comprising:
- (a) an insertion needle sized to be received concentrically within the catheter sleeve for insertion of said catheter sleeve along with said insertion needle below a patient'"'"'s skin;
(b) a barrel adapted to receive a plunger;
(c) a plunger, including an interior cavity and a frangible end adjacent thereto, said plunger sized to be received within and slide through said barrel; and
(d) a spring housing means associated with and attachable to said barrel, for holding said insertion needle and selectively retracting said insertion needle into said interior cavity of said plunger when said plunger abuts against a surface within said barrel and moves beyond a portion of said barrel, causing breakage of said frangible end, and allowing said frangible end of said plunger to separate, wherein said spring housing means comprises;
a holder for holding said insertion needle; and
a spring means for exerting an expansive force between an end of said holder and said spring housing means, wherein said spring housing means selectively holds said holder and said spring means therebetween, while allowing said insertion needle to extend from said spring housing means in an assembled condition, wherein said spring housing means has extending resilient finger with interior and inferiorally positioned hooks to retain said end of said holder in an assembled condition wherein said frangible end of said plunger has an engaging and complementing surface which abuts up against said hooks of said extending resilient fingers, spreading said extending resilient fingers radially outwardly to release said end of said holder against the expansive force of said spring means when said plunger moves beyond said portion of said barrel, and wherein said spring housing means is attachable to said barrel and lockable thereto, preventing removal of said spring housing means from said barrel.

Abstract
A hypodermic injection system (7) with a retractable needle (9) wherein the needle (9) retracts within an interior cavity of a syringe plunger (59), such that the needle (9) is confinedly held within the plunger (59). A cylindrical spring housing assembly (21) has resilient fingers (23) which captures a spring (15) biasly holding a needle holder (11) against the retaining force of resilient fingers (23). The plunger (59) has a frangible end (65), which dissociates when the outwardly tapered shoulders (68) spread the resilient fingers (23), allowing the coiled spring (15) to eject the needle (9) and its holder (11) into the interior cavity (71) of the plunger (59). A body fluid sampling embodiment employs the same functional elements except the plunger (59") is shorter and contains a linking (137) that communicates with a vacuum container (147). The container allows fluid sampling and provides the structure to release the spring (15 ") retracting the needle (9"). The retractable needle embodiment is also employed with an insertion needle (9'"'"'") that guides a catheter tube (154) below the skin of a patient and into the vein, and allows retraction of the insertion needle (9'"'"'") thereby avoiding accidental pricking of the health care worker by the insertion needle (9'"'"'").
